Event summary

This earthquake is expected to have a low humanitarian impact based on the magnitude and the affected population and their vulnerability.

Earthquake Magnitude: 5.4M
Depth: 105.19 Km
Lat/Lon: -31.39 , -69.14
Event Date: 10 Dec 2013 00:51 UTC
09 Dec 2013 21:51 Local
Exposed Population:
626163 people within 100km
Source: NEIC
Inserted at: 10 Dec 2013 01:08 UTC

Exposed population

The earthquake happened in Argentina , Province of San Juan (population 547,865) .

Radius Population
100 km 630000 people
75 km 550000 people
50 km 13000 people
20 km <1000 people
10 km <1000 people
5 km <1000 people
2 km <1000 people

Affected Provinces

Country Region Province Population
Argentina San Juan 550000 people
Argentina Mendoza 1.5 million people
